Beginning May 1 through May 24, 2024, the San Luis Obispo County Air Pollution Control District (APCD) Hearing Board is recruiting for four positions: an Attorney Member, an Attorney Alternate, a Public Alternate and Engineer Alternate. State law requires the Attorney Member and Alternate to be admitted to the practice of law in California, the Engineer Alternate be a registered professional engineer and appointment of Hearing Board members be made by the APCD Board of Directors.
The APCD Hearing Board is a quasi-judicial body whose purpose is to hear requests from regulated industry for a variance from rules, hear requests for orders of abatement concerning air quality public nuisance issues, and other areas of jurisdiction set by the State Health and Safety Code. Membership requirements for the Hearing Board are stipulated in state law and specify members and alternates consist of an attorney admitted to the practice of law in California, a registered professional engineer, a member of the medical profession, and two public members.
